Output 53be21f6a5fbb55842362609711b81870e8f8d3123034fcfcc96ed8e5acfca36:2

value
786596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6023810f89aafa499054bb1d098212a0d067629 OP_EQUAL
address
3MCbBmu3hiF2zTpseJej8G8mG4eoRTn3zM
transaction
53be21f6a5fbb55842362609711b81870e8f8d3123034fcfcc96ed8e5acfca36
spent
true